How To Choose The Best Electric Roasting Pan With Lid
Selecting the right roaster is about more than just size. It’s about finding a balance between capacity, control, and convenience that fits your cooking style and kitchen logistics.
Capacity and Size
Capacity is measured in quarts and directly correlates to the size of bird you can cook. An 18-quart model typically fits a 22-24 lb turkey, while 26-28 quart units can handle 30 lbs or more. Consider not just the turkey, but also if you plan to add vegetables or need space for a rack. Always measure your counter space and storage area, as these units have a large footprint.
Lid Design and Function
The lid is critical for moisture retention. A self-basting lid has a domed design with interior ridges that collect condensation and drip it back onto the meat, promoting juiciness. Some lids have a glass window, allowing you to monitor progress without losing heat. Ensure the lid fits snugly and has cool-touch handles for safety.
Temperature Control and Versatility
Look for a wide temperature range, ideally from 150°F to 450°F. This allows for slow cooking, roasting, baking, and a keep-warm function. A precise thermostat is key for consistent results. Some models include a dedicated defrost setting, which can be a significant time-saver.
Ease of Cleaning
A removable roasting pan is essential. It allows you to carry the pan to the sink for cleaning and is often dishwasher safe. Check if the rack and lid are also dishwasher safe. Enamel-on-steel or non-stick coatings on the pan can make cleanup much easier.

Understanding the Specs
Quarts vs. Turkey Pounds
Capacity is the most critical spec. A general rule: an 18-quart roaster fits a 22-24 lb turkey, a 26-quart handles up to 30 lbs. Remember to account for the rack, which lifts the bird, and any vegetables. If you regularly host large gatherings or want ample space for drippings, opting for a larger capacity (26-28 QT) provides flexibility.
Wattage and Heat-Up Time
Most roasters operate at 1450 watts. This consistent wattage means they generally heat up faster and cook more quickly than a traditional home oven, which is a key advantage for saving time. The trade-off is that cooking times in recipes must often be adjusted downward, and close monitoring with a meat thermometer is essential to prevent overcooking.
The Self-Basting Lid Mechanism
This isn’t just marketing. A properly designed self-basting lid has a domed interior with ridges or a specific contour. As steam rises and condenses on the cooler lid surface, these channels direct the moisture to drip back down evenly over the food, continuously basting it. This mechanical process is why these roasters are renowned for exceptionally juicy results without manual intervention.
Temperature Range & Control
A range from 150°F to 450°F is ideal. The low end (150-200°F) is for slow cooking, warming, and proofing bread. The high end (400-450°F) is for searing and initial browning. The knob-controlled thermostat is simple but effective; its accuracy is more important than having digital displays. The “Defrost” setting typically cycles the element on and off at a low power to thaw safely.
